BBRFC – Arendonk
Written by Nicolas Becuwe Thursday, 17 November 2011 16:11
2011 Sunday November the 13th 3 PM
After a two-weeks break, the Baa-baas were hungry for rugby and hungry for victory. On a very foggy day, they emerged together from the changing rooms with the will the fight for one another and exhibiting nasty and aggressive faces. The atmosphere before the game was tense, the Baa-baas concentrated on listening to the war-like words of their coach, Arnaud.
Arendonk won the toss and elected to kick-off. The beginning of the game was not to the advantage of the Baa-baas who spent the first five minutes camped in their own 22. Arendonk's giants, led by Vercingetorix, came within centimeters of the try line, yet their assaults were stopped by an iron defense. However, Arendonk finally converted their chances through a penalty (3-0). The Baa-baas came back in the game and after the first difficult minutes they were starting to assert some domination on the game. A good lineout in the opposite twenty-two formed the basis for Patrick to take and beat two or three players to score the first try of the game, converted by Nick straight after. The Baa-baas were now unstoppable,
being aggressive in defense and in the scrums, breaking the opposite line and stealing balls in the rucks. A penalty tapped by Julien ten meters from the try line of Arendonk led to Pierre destroying the opposition to score the second try of the game.
The game proceeded with more tension and aggression from both teams, and Antoine, after a contretemps with an opposition player, was to be found bleeding from the face on the ground. The hero of the day had to leave the pitch and was replaced by Oli at inside center. This did not stop the baa-baas, rather to the contrary it contributed to increase the aggressiveness of the team. The Baa-baas were continuously pushing and the game was played out in the Arendonk half. From a line-out, their fly-half Nick took the ball and slalomed around the Arendonk line to score the third try of the match, which he duly converted. Michel, just before the end of the half, took the ball on the wing to score the fourth try (24 – 3).
The second half started with the same intensity as the first. The Baa-baas were soon in Arendonk's territory once more, the pack moving forward with good mauls and Bernardo stealing a lot of balls from the opponents in the air. However, after 5 or 10 minutes, the Baa-baas' machine was less powerful and the match was now became more balanced. Nevertheless, Baa-baas' defense was a solid bulwark to the attacks of Arendonk. Five minutes before the end of the game, Patrick scored the final try of the game in the right corner (29 - 3).
The referee blew the final whistle and Baa-baas were headed to celebrate this massive win in the Europa. A great win obtained with passion and aggression after four consecutive defeats: like true champions, they did not quit, coming back stronger from this tricky period. The Baa-baas are now looking to the rest of the championship with their heads up, hoping to repeat the same team performance.
The rest is for the record: celebrations at the local pub, 3 new players baptized in the customary manner (technically, two were already gone, meaning substitutes in their stead) and 5 stitches for Antoine. 29-3, and looking forward Brigandze next week!
